Subject: [Buildroot] [PATCH 1/2] libglib2: fix compilation when compiler has no builtin atomic

+diff --git a/glib/gatomic.c b/glib/gatomic.c
+index 845c866..01468ce 100644
+--- a/glib/gatomic.c
++++ b/glib/gatomic.c
+@@ -881,6 +881,7 @@ g_atomic_pointer_compare_and_exchange (volatile gpointer G_GNUC_MAY_ALIAS *atomi
+ #endif /* DEFINE_WITH_WIN32_INTERLOCKED */
+
+ #ifdef DEFINE_WITH_MUTEXES
++# include "gthread.h"
+ /* We have to use the slow, but safe locking method */
+ static GMutex *g_atomic_mutex;
+
